DescriptionThis compound belongs to the class of organic compounds known as 2-naphthalene sulfonates. These are organic aromatic compounds that contain a naphthalene moiety that carries a sulfonic acid group at the 2-position. Naphthalene is a bicyclic compound that is made up of two fused benzene ring.
